OMB is pleased to announce that Oksana Kigilyuk has joined its residential lending team as vice president, mortgage loan officer.
Kigilyuk has nearly 20 years of lending experience with 13 years specializing in mortgage lending. She joined Bank of Little Rock Mortgage in 2014 and was most recently a mortgage loan officer at Home Mortgage Group.
“We are thrilled to welcome Oksana to OMB’s growing mortgage team,” said Michael Frerking, director of residential lending. “Her vast lending knowledge, dedication to exceptional customer service and strong referral partners will be a great addition to our team and OMB Bank.”
Kigilyuk, who also speaks fluent Russian and Ukrainian, will office at OMB’s 3570 S. National location in Springfield. The bank offers conventional, FHA, VA, USDA and jumbo home loans at competitive rates as well as free home loan pre-qualification.
